World Oceans Day 'Flash Mob' in Dakar
In Dakar, hundreds of oceans lovers, fishers and Greenpeace volunteers celebrate World Oceans Day. The event is held on the “Parcours Sportif", one of the most famous beaches of Senegal where people gather every afternoon for jogging and sports. The activists demonstrate how they all rely on healthy and beautiful oceans through a choreographed "flash mob" accompanied by music. Participants, some wearing fish costumes, display banners with the messages “We Love Oceans” and “Healthy Oceans, Happy Communities.” In the picture the participants pose for a group photo at the end of the activity.
